Reality is that you can wear whatever prosthetic arm you want \u2013 none, low tech, high price \u2013 and you STILL will be an amputee, you will have the same exact social problems no matter what, and change is not in sight. It is honorable to see you team up with Hugh Herr whose job it is to get funding for his academic projects \u2013 but arm amputees have been the butt of industry hypes since the Carnes arm. All arms are too expensive, too heavy, lacking function and integration with the human body. No body prosthesis interface really works \u2013 osseointegration bolts break and draw infections like nothing else. Sockets slip, cause skin problems, restrict motion, can be uncomfortable. Skin electrodes are not too reliable, and their function degrades once you sweat. Multi-articulated hands suck batteries empty like nothing else; sufficient power is heavy. These hands are fragile, their motors are loud. The whole idea of prostheses being anywhere near to even a minimal real hand function is entirely ludicrous.
